DAMASCUS, (ST)- Minister of Petroleum and Mineral Resources Ali Suleiman Al-Abbas recently discussed with the Ambassador of the Republic of South Africa Sean Benfeldt ways of cooperation in the field of oil, gas and investing in mineral wealth.
The two sides discussed the possibility of investing in the field of development and manufacture of phosphate industries and the partnership in the existing refinery projects in Syria, the establishment of joint ventures in the field of oil services and in the field of exploration.
The Minister welcomed the Republic of South Africa’s companies wishing to invest in Syria in the field of oil, stressing that “companies of friendly countries will have priority in the investment opportunities available in the future.”
For his part, the ambassador expressed his desire to brief on investment opportunities in the oil, gas and mineral wealth and create opportunities for cooperation of mutual interest to the two peoples in the two countries.
